MailBiff is a shareware OS/2 Warp WPS aware mail notification utility.
This document explains how to install MailBiff. It explains command line
syntaxes and how to get the program(s) running. A separate document
(order.frm) tells you how to register MailBiff.

MailBiff 1.01 installation instructions:
==================================
1. Unpack the MB*.ZIP archive in a private directory (UNZIP.EXE
works nicely). MB 1.0 requires its own home directory (FAT or
HPFS, doesn't matter).
2. Run the provided MBCREATE.CMD (a simple REXX program) in that
directory to build a WPS object for each POP3 mail server you have.
3. Double click on the new icon to start it.
Prerequisites
==============
You must have the rxsock.dll from the iak or Warp COnnect for this utility
to execute.
Command line Parms
==================
-server < name of pop3 server >
-user < your userid >
-pass < your password >
-refresh < how often to check for mail in seconds >
-wps will cause the wps icon to be changed to reflect the mail count
-detach will prevent the vio text window from displaying and will produce mb.log
Caution when you are testing your paramters from the command line do not include
the -wps switch if you do the wps icon for the command prompt will be changed!!
